Hi Axel,

> can you explain what conditions are required for an object to get merged with another one?

It needs to have a well formed set of curves produced by the surface/surface intersections.

If there are anomalies in the geometry like areas where a surface or edge is folded back on itself in self intersections that can cause problems.
